All of Doni Burdick's recordings seem to be using backing tracks like his out of tune 'Candle' that uses the Dynamics 'I Need Your Love' and 'Whatcha Gonna Do' uses September Jones Chink A Chank Baby. I Have Faith In You is Edwin Starr's backing track and credits the right writers but changes the producers, only 'Open The Door To Your Heart' seems to be a fully legit cover with the proper credits.
